NewsIP camera Nextiva S2750e : Verint Systems announced the extension of its IP camera line with the Nextiva S2750e, a feature-rich and cost-effective mini-dome IP camera. The S2750e mini-dome IP camera leverages Verint’s industry-leading video encoding technology for high resolution viewing without overburdening available network bandwidth or storage. The Nextiva S2750e is specifically designed for a use in a variety of indoor environments, including retail stores, banks and campuses, where deployment often presents a challenge. “The Nextiva 2750e was designed to meet the market need for a versatile and cost-effective IP camera solution that is easy to implement,” said Jim Clark, General Manager of Verint Video Intelligence Solutions.

Jim Clark added: “Flexible deployment options and excellent image quality make the Nextiva 2750e ideal in point-to-point applications or, when combined with our Nextiva video management software, as a powerful component an end-to-end enterprise IP security solution.”





Nextiva 2750e IP camera - Specifications
• Provides excellent image quality with VGA at 30 FPS, MPEG4 or MJPEG
• Designed for ease of implementation and maintenance with precision triple-axis lens rotation, and analog output for easy on-site installations
• Power-over-Ethernet for increased flexibility and reduced installation costs
• Durable mini-dome housing enables installation on walls, ceilings & electrical boxes. Pendant and pole-mount accessories also available.
• Captures clear images under low light conditions (minimum illumination of 0.7 lux) with a vari-focal (4-9mm) and DC auto-iris lens
• Dynamic noise reduction filter optimizes bit rate for highly efficient video transfer over IP networks
• Web-based viewing, configuration and maintenance for simple management
• Support for ISO-compliant MPEG4 and dual streaming

Nextiva portfolio - IP cameras
The Nextiva portfolio of networked video solutions includes video management software, integrated analytics, encoders and IP cameras, intelligent DVRs and robust SDKs and integrations for use in a variety of vertical market environments. Nextiva enables organizations of all sizes, from small and mid-sized enterprises to major government and commercial organizations, to enhance the security of their facilities and infrastructure and the performance of their business operations by networking video across multiple locations and applying advanced content analytics to extract actionable intelligence from live and stored video. By alerting security personnel to potential security threats, Nextiva helps organizations prevent security breaches, improve response time and enhance operational efficiency.

Verint Systems
Verint Systems Inc., headquartered in Melville, New York, is a leading provider of analytic software-based solutions for workforce-enterprise optimization and security. Verint software, which is used by over 5,000 organizations in over 100 countries worldwide, generates actionable intelligence through the collection, retention and analysis of voice, fax, video, email, Internet and data transmissions from multiple communications networks.
